Without doubt Carlo Cudicini - the greatest keeper to spend the most of the time on the bench rather than between the sticks. Granted he was behind Cech when it came to the goalkeeping stakes , but still a class above the majority of those playing week in , week out for other clubs. 141 appearances in a 10 year period at Chelsea (with the vast majority of those being 2000-2003) shows him to have spent more time warming his hands on the bench than pulling on his gloves for the 1st team. Also one of the best penalty stoppers in the game.

Do you remember Tony Warner at Liverpool. The players nicknamed him Bonus because he got thousands of pounds in win bonuses for being on the bench week in week out, but never actually played a senior game in his 9 years at the club!
